Joanne Battaglini, 86, passed away peacefully in Vero Beach, Florida on January 27, 2022.

She was born to the late Peter and Irene (Nicholas) Hronis on August 1, 1935 in Endicott, NY where she graduated from Union-Endicott High School. She married her high-school sweetheart, the late Donald Kenneth (Ken) Battaglini, and together they raised their family in nearby Endwell. They later moved to Surfside Beach, SC where they enjoyed many winters in the sunshine.

Small in stature, Joanne was a spitfire. She had a big personality, big heart and big laugh. She loved gardening and golfing, bowling and volleyball, and had a flair for color, design and decorating. Never one to sit idle, Joanne was talented in all things creative – crochet, knitting, macramé – but her greatest passion and expertise was sewing. She would burn the midnight oil making clothes for her family and friends, bridesmaid dresses, Barbie doll clothes, draperies, bedding and upholstery, and doing alterations. She and Ken successfully merged their Greek and Italian heritages, and enjoyed cooking their specialty dishes and entertaining family and friends at their home where everyone was welcome.

While raising her family, Joanne managed a furniture store where her people skills and talent in interior design were on full display. She loved to visit customers' homes to design room layouts, and eventually became the corporate buyer and trainer over all the stores in upstate NY. In her retirement, she started her own small business – Little Blessings – making heirloom christening gowns.

In her later years, Joanne never let Alzheimer's define her. Even as the disease progressed, her character never changed; she remained the lively, personable and caring person that she always was.
